Geranyl acetate

Description:
Geranyl acetate is an organic compound classified as an ester, specifically the acetate of geraniol. It is characterized by its pleasant, fruity aroma, often associated with citrus and floral notes, making it a popular ingredient in perfumes, cosmetics, and flavorings. The molecular formula of geranyl acetate is C12H22O2, and it has a molecular weight of approximately 198.31 g/mol. This compound is typically a colorless to pale yellow liquid that is insoluble in water but soluble in organic solvents. Geranyl acetate is known for its volatility, which contributes to its use in fragrance applications. Additionally, it exhibits antimicrobial properties, which can enhance its utility in various formulations. The compound is generally recognized as safe when used in appropriate concentrations, although it may cause skin irritation in some individuals. Its synthesis usually involves the esterification of geraniol with acetic acid or acetic anhydride, highlighting its relevance in both natural and synthetic chemistry contexts.
